Character Illustration: from Sketch to Vector
The character started out as a hand drawn sketch based on a supplied photo of the owner, who wanted to use a caricature as part of the logo. Instead of the traditional, goofy caricature style that’s so common at carnivals, our artist took a modern, chic, borderless approach. Finished with soft, bright colours and a subtle polka dot texture, the Walk N Roll logo is quirky, fun, and feminine.

We also provided Walk N Roll with luxury business cards with a spot UV (selective gloss) finish – the polka dots were done as tone-on-tone. The bright red food truck also received large decals, resulting in vehicle that looks like no other and which can be identified from blocks away!
